Hapa Taqueria- Taco Review

The girls and I wanted to try a new taco place~ Hapa Taqueria (275 S. 200 W., SLC).  We had read great reviews on Yelp including a few that excited us around $1 tacos. 

They boasted yummy street-style tacos.  Yes, they were yummy and small (street-style).  But they were not $1.  They are $2.50 each.  I can eat one of those in like three bites.  We also heard they had a tasty brussel sprout dish.  And tasty it was.

However, service was super slow. Our waiter was nice, but S.L.O.W. and they were not busy.

Overall, good food, but slow service and overpriced for what we received. I probably will not go back unless someone else pays.
